Shot on 8mm film in 1951, this vintage footage captures a historic European market square in West Germany. The sequence opens on a prominent statue of a figure holding a flag atop an ornate column, surrounded by traditional buildings with shuttered windows and flower boxes. The camera pans slightly, revealing architectural details like a bay window and classic facades. The grainy black-and-white image evokes a nostalgic, archival feel, offering a glimpse into mid-century urban life in post-war Germany.
